The number “13” is an unluckly number — at least for a South Kitsap man.

Bail was set for $1 million for a Olalla man who remains in custody in the Kitsap County Jail after he was arrested for a 13th time for suspicion of driving under the influence on Oct. 30.

Charles Thomas Sorensen, 49, was charged Oct. 31 in Kitsap County District Court with one count of felony driving under the influence (DUI) and one count of attempting to elude a police vehicle.

According to charging papers, Washington State Patrol reported they spotted grass and branches stuck underneath Sorensen’s 1997 white Chevrolet pickup on a South Kitsap road about 10 p.m. Wednesday. Sorensen failed to stop after state troopers activated lights and sirens on Long Lake Road. He finally stopped after turning onto Clover Valley. Troopers reported Sorensen was “swaying heavily” with bloodshot eyes and “smelled heavily of intoxicants.” They said the man apparently crashed his truck in a ditch near Sedgwick at Banner Road.

Court documents stated that Sorensen refused a breath test, but a search warrant allowed deputies to take two blood samples. Troopers discovered an open bottle of vodka and a half-empty beer bottle.

Court records show that Sorensen had been arrested in 2003, 2004, 2006 and 2007 for DUI.
